|
svk 1.01 is released: msg#00012version-control.svk.devel
Hi all, I'm very pleased to announce svk 1.01, a bugfix release 2 months after the 1.00 release. This release fixes many edge cases, and also improves performance and memory usage. Binary packages should be available later this week. Enjoy, [Changes for 1.01 - 11 Jul, 2005] * Fix a memory leak when constructing copy cache for revisions involving many changed paths. * Fix a memory leak when updating directories containing lots of files. * Fix memory leaks when having mixed-revision checkout with many entries. * Fix a segfault in patch creation and viewing triggered by copy+modification files. * Fix a bug in svk diff: diffing deeply added directory triggers "checkout_delta called with non-dir". * Fix a bug that when copy destination's basepath does not exist, svk prompts for url initialisation. * Partially fix a bug that deleting a path containing mirrors will result in inconsistent mirror state. * Fix svk ls -f to list the path, instead of depot root path. [Autrijus] * Fix a bug that push (smerge -I) will use wrongly encoded commit message if you are not using utf8. [Jorge Daza <jorge@xxxxxxxxxxx>] * Fix a crash bug when switch to a branch that has new files with keywords. * When checkout to existing directory, if the directory is from the very same depotpath, do an update instead of dying. This resembles the svn and cvs behaviour. * Fix patch list/view/dump/delete for those can't be applied. [Jody Belka] * Fix svk checkout --detach to detach a checkout even if the directory's parent no longer exists. [Jody Belka] * svk checkout --list now shows removed checkout with '?', and supports --purge. [David Glasser] * Fix a bug that a file is not properly handled when a symlink is overwritten by file, without proper replace. * Fix a bug that patch --apply thinks the commit fails and save the commit message to a temp file. * svk blame now takes --remoterev to show remote revision. * svk sync -a now does the right thing on given depotpath. [Jody Belka] * make svk update, ls, and cat use new revspec parser so they support remote-revision form and friends. [gugod] * Pull as a lump under all conditions, even depot path. [Norman Nunley] * Misc documentation and tests fixes and improvements. [jesse,knewt,matthewd,Tom Sibley] * Fix the autouse hack so Devel::DProf works again. Cheers, CLK |
|
| <Prev in Thread] | Current Thread | [Next in Thread> |
|---|---|---|
| Previous by Date: | Mirror source already removed: 00012, Manuel Vacelet |
|---|---|
| Next by Date: | svk 1.01 darwinports port: 00012, Daniel J. Luke |
| Previous by Thread: | Mirror source already removedi: 00012, Manuel Vacelet |
| Next by Thread: | Mac OS X binaries for svk 1.01 released: 00012, Michael Brouwer |
| Indexes: | [Date] [Thread] [Top] [All Lists] |
| News | FAQ | advertise |